  • Biodegradation of azo dye RO16 in different reactors by immobilized Irpex lacteus
    Bolčič Tavčar, Mateja, 1980- ...
    Irpex lacteus is a white rot fungus known to decolorize various synthetic dyes. Decolorization of the azo dye Reactive Orange 16 by immobilized culturesof I. lacteus was compared in three different ... reactor systems of laboratory size: small and large trickle-bed reactors and a rotating-disc reactor. The highest dye decolorization efficiency (90% in 3 days) was observed in the small trickle bed reactor. The production of extracellular ligninolytic enzymes during dye decolorization was measured and the involvement of mycelium-associated activities in the decolorization process assessed. A repeated batch performance test demonstrated the potential of immobilized fungal cultures to decolorize synthetic dyes over long time periods.
